
Digital Marketing Campaign Coordinator
Hanwha Vision America, Teaneck, NJ, United States
Title: Digital Marketing Campaign Coordinator (TEMP)
Location: Teaneck, NJ
Hanwha Vision America (HVA), is an affiliate of the Hanwha Group, a Fortune Global 500 company. HVA is an industry-leading provider of advanced network video surveillance products, including IP cameras, storage devices, and video management systems founded on world-class technologies. We offer end-to-end security solutions and have achieved global success across a wide range of industry verticals including retail, transportation, education, banking, healthcare, hospitality and airports.
Hanwha Vision America (HVA) is seeking a Digital Marketing Campaign Coordinator (Temp) plays a key role in driving engagement, lead nurturing, and pipeline growth through organic social media, email marketing, and marketing automation. Sitting within the Digital Marketing team, this role is responsible for executing high-impact campaigns, managing always-on nurture strategies, managing lead quality, and ensuring seamless alignment between marketing engagement and sales readiness.
This position requires a highly detail-oriented, self-motivated marketer who can prioritize across multiple initiatives, proactively promote campaigns, and optimize performance through data-driven insights.
Key Responsibilities
Own and execute organic social media strategy, including content planning, publishing, and performance optimization across key platforms
Develop and manage email marketing campaigns, including newsletters, product promotions, event communications, and nurture programs
Build, optimize, and scale automated workflows and lifecycle campaigns in HubSpot (or similar platforms)
Manage inbound leads from digital channels (social, web, events, gated content) and ensure proper segmentation, scoring, and routing
Monitor campaign performance across email and social, using data to continuously refine targeting, messaging, and timing
Partner with teams to ensure timely follow-up and alignment on lead quality, lifecycle stages, and handoff processes
Maintain and optimize marketing automation and CRM integrations (HubSpot, Salesforce), ensuring data accuracy and consistency
Proactively identify opportunities to amplify campaigns organically, increase engagement, and extend content reach
Support A/B testing across email and social campaigns to improve conversion and engagement rates
Manage multiple projects simultaneously, ensuring deadlines are met with a high level of accuracy and attention to detail
Qualifications & Requirements
3?5 years of experience in digital marketing, social media, and email marketing
Hands-on experience with marketing automation platforms (HubSpot required; Salesforce is a plus)
Strong background in email marketing strategy, execution, and performance optimization
Proven experience managing organic social media channels and growing engagement
Highly detail-oriented with strong organizational and project management skills
Ability to self-prioritize, work independently, and proactively drive initiatives forward
Attention to detail - Strong writing and communication skills, with the ability to craft compelling, audience-focused messaging
Analytical mindset with experience interpreting campaign performance and optimizing accordingly
Nice-to-Have Skills
Experience with A/B testing and campaign optimization across channels
Familiarity with lead scoring models and lifecycle marketing strategies
Experience supporting ABM or integrated marketing campaigns
Knowledge of B2B marketing funnels and conversion strategies
